HD 38229 is a G5-type star located in the constellation of Auriga. Sitting at a distance of approximately 508 ly from Earth, it shines with an apparent magnitude of 6.47, making it an interesting target for observation. It is officially recorded in the Hipparcos catalog as HIP 27293.
